Mixed-Heritage Pactbinder Builds: Power and Secrets

The adaptable half-elf race pairs well with the dark nature of the Warlock class, allowing for exceptionally dangerous and mysterious character concepts. Merging elven finesse with human determination, these concepts often excel at influence and decisive spellcasting. Consider options like the Blade Pact for a combat-focused warlock, or the Chain Pact to gain a loyal familiar for information gathering. Alternatively, the Pact of the Tome can bestow access to additional low-level spells, expanding your mystic potential. Here's a glimpse of what you can expect:

  • Improved Presence – crucial for spellcasting.
  • Innate Shadow Sight – helps exploration.
  • Ability to additional expertise, like Deception or Charm.
